Last official estimated population of Roper town (Washington County**, North Carolina state) was 579 (year 2014)[1]. This was 0% of total US population and 0.01% of total North Carolina state population. Area of Roper town is 0.9 mi² (=2.2 km²)[6], in this year population density was 676.40 p/mi². If population growth rate would be same as in period 2010-2014 (-1.34%/yr), Roper town population in 2026 would be 493*.
